Why This Matters in the Triangle

Apex, Cary, Holly Springs, and Fuquay-Varina went through a massive building boom between 2000 and 2015. That means a lot of homes are now running original equipment that's 10 to 25 years old. Systems installed during that era were solid, but they weren't designed for the efficiency standards we have today. Many are running SEER 10–13 when modern units hit SEER 16–20+.

And Triangle summers are no joke. When it's 95 degrees for weeks straight — which happens every July and August — your AC runs 10 to 14 hours a day. Duke Energy customers in Wake County regularly see summer electric bills north of $200 a month. An aging system makes that worse.

Common Air Purification Systems Problems in Creedmoor

Builder-Grade AC in Growing Subdivisions

Creedmoor's popular new developments like Falls Pointe and Lyon Farm often include basic single-stage AC systems that can struggle with humidity control during North Carolina's hottest, most humid weeks.

Falls Lake Humidity Amplifying Cooling Load

Creedmoor's proximity to Falls Lake creates higher ambient humidity that forces AC systems to work harder on moisture removal, a particular challenge for older systems and undersized equipment.

Aging Systems in Downtown and Rural Areas

Older Creedmoor homes near downtown and along Hawley School Road have AC systems that are 15-20+ years old, operating on outdated refrigerants with declining efficiency.

Two-Story Cooling Imbalance

Newer Creedmoor homes with two-story layouts commonly experience 5-8°F temperature differences between floors due to single-zone systems and heat naturally rising to upper levels.

How does Falls Lake affect AC performance in Creedmoor?

Falls Lake creates elevated humidity levels in Creedmoor that force AC systems to work harder on moisture removal. Standard single-stage systems often can't run long enough to properly dehumidify, leaving homes feeling clammy. Variable-speed systems with dedicated dehumidification modes handle this challenge effectively.

Should I upgrade the AC in my new Creedmoor home?

If your new Creedmoor home has a basic single-stage AC, upgrading to a variable-speed system can improve humidity control, reduce energy costs by 20-30%, and provide more even cooling — especially important in two-story homes near Falls Lake where humidity is higher.
